Fertilization is essential for promoting healthy plant growth, dynamic foliage, and robust root systems. A well balanced supply of nutrients-- primarily nitrogen, phosphorus, and potassium-- is needed to support different plant functions, from leaf development to blooming and tension tolerance. Soil testing assists determine particular shortages and guide fertilization methods. Fertilizer application can be granular, liquid, slow-release, or organic, depending on plant requirements, soil conditions, and ecological considerations. Timing and dose are important to prevent over-fertilization, nutrient runoff, or plant damage. Seasonal scheduling makes sure plants get nutrients when they are most needed, supporting peak development durations. Regular fertilization strengthens plant durability versus insects, illness, and environmental stressors. A well-nourished landscape preserves visual appeal and long-lasting health, optimizing the return on maintenance efforts
